REALITY (R)

From "A Face in the Crowd" (1957) to "The King of Comedy" (1982), we've seen people unraveled by imagined fame. Luciano, is a charming fishmonger in Naples, Italy. He has a loving family and close friends, but all that is forgotten after he auditions for the Big Brother TV Show.

Soon, he becomes obsessed and paranoid about the fake world of "reality" TV. The lead actor, Aniello Arena, was discovered in a prison theatre production. This cautionary tale, based on a true story, speaks to us across all languages. In Italian with English subtitles.

Three hats.

JURASSIC PARK 3D (PG-13)

Twenty years ago this sci-fi action film captured the public imagination and swept the box office. Too many movies have recently been converted to 3-D from 2-D, but here is one movie that benefits not only from the reissue but the reconceived.

The story of a scientist and his wondrous animal park is beautifully produced, written and directed with simplicity, heart and perfectly-timed thrills by Steven Spielberg. If a new generation of moviegoers is finally seeing this movie, I hope they study Spielberg's storytelling skills. If you've already seen it, see it again in 3-D. This is popcorn fun.

Four hats.
